O R D E R
The prayer sought for in this Writ Petition is for a Writ of Certiorarified Mandamus, calling for the records pertaining to the order passed by the second respondent in his proceedings in Na.Ka.37992/C1/E1/2018 dated 14.06.2018 and quash the same and direct the respondents to permit the petitioner to continue in Ayyanar Corporation High School, Melur, Srirangam, Trichy District. 2.Heard Mr.V.Panneer Selvam, learned Counsel appearing for the petitioner and Mr.D.Muruganantham, learned Additional Government Pleader appearing for the respondents.
3.The learned Counsel appearing for the petitioner would submit that, the petitioner is working as Headmaster in Ayyanar Corporation High School, Melur, Srirangam, Trichy District and in order to take treatment for the psychologically affected child of the petitioner, he wanted to get transferred near to Chennai, as the treatment
facilities are available only in Chennai. Therefore, he requested for transfer to Chennai by participating in the general counseling. 4.Pursuant to his request, he has been transferred from Trichy to Kancheepuram, by order dated 14.06.2018. However, it is unfortunate that the petitioner's wife became sick suddenly and the petitioner is also having only seven months of service. Therefore, if the petitioner goes to Chennai, his wife's condition will further get deteriorated. Therefore, the petitioner has made a request to cancel the said transfer and to retain him in Trichy vide representation dated 18.06.2018.
5.The learned Counsel appearing for the petitioner would submit that the petitioner is still working in the place from where he was transferred i.e., Ayyanar Corporation High School, Melur, Trichy and he has not been relieved so far.
6.I have heard Mr.D.Muruganathan, learned Additional Government Pleader appearing for the respondents, who would submit that the said impugned order dated 14.06.2018, was issued only at the instance of the petitioner and based on the request he made while participating in the general counseling. However, the petitioner so far has not moved from the said place and he is still working there. If at all, the petitioner is expressing difficulty now through his representation dated 18.06.2018, the same would be considered by the respondents within a time frame.
7.Considering the said submissions made by both sides, without going into the merits of the challenge made by the petitioner against the impugned order, this Court is inclined to pass the following order:
"The respondents are directed to consider the representation of the petitioner dated 18.06.2018, on the ground of health condition of the wife of the petitioner and also by taking into account that the petitioner has so far not been relieved from Trichy and by taking a pragmatic view, within a period of six [6] weeks from the date of receipt of a copy of this order. Since the petitioner has not been relieved so far, till a decision is taken by the respondents, the petitioner need not be disturbed." 8.With the above directions, this Writ Petition stands disposed of.
